Fibrocartilage
A type of tough, very dense, white connective tissue with a matrix containing collagen fibers, providing support and shock absorption.
Synchondrosis
A type of joint where bones are joined by hyaline cartilage, allowing very little or no movement between the bones.
Syndesmosis
A fibrous joint at which two bones are bound by long collagen fibers, allowing for minimal movement, typically found between the tibia and fibula.
